#7b1699 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7b1699 is composed of 48.2% red, 8.6% green and 60%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 19.6% cyan, 85.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 40% black. It has a hue angle of 286.3 degrees, a saturation of 74.9% and a lightness of 34.3%. #7b1699 color hex could be obtained by blending #f62cff with #000033. Closest websafe color is: #660099.

#7b1699 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7b1699 has RGB values of R:123, G:22, B:153 and CMYK values of C:0.2, M:0.86, Y:0, K:0.4. Its decimal value is 8066713.

Shades and Tints of #7b1699
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0210 is the darkest color, while #fffe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#7b1699
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5a535c is the less saturated color, while #8602ad is the most saturated one.
